Women's track takes home two major awards from SAA

5/14/2025 10:00:00 AM

ATLANTA - Earlier today the Southern Athletic Association released its postseason awards for the 2025 outdoor track & field season as voted on by the league's coaches and Centre brought in two of the major awards with Track Athlete of the Week Madjo Doumbia and Field Athlete of the Week Serena McNeilly.

Doumbia accounted for five school records during the outdoor portion of her senior season. She racked up 38.5 points for the Colonels at the SAA Championships to help the Colonels win, setting school records in the 100m, 200m, 400m and 4x100m relay along the way and earning High Point Scorer of the Meet honors. She also was part of the 4x400m squad that set a school record at a last chance meet at Liberty University last week. Doumbia currently ranks in the top 15 on the NCAA Performance List in three different events, including third nationally in the 100m.

McNeilly was a two-time event champion at the outdoor conference championships, earning victories in the triple jump and high jump. The 2025 NCAA Indoor high jump national runner-up set a new outdoor high mark of 5-7.75 in the high jump during the heptathlon at the Berry Field Day. During that same heptathlon, she set a school record with 4,404 points. McNeilly is ranked in the top 15 nationally in both the triple jump and high jump, topping out at third in the country in the high jump.

The NCAA Track & Field Championships will release the 2025 Outdoor field on May 18.
